PICTURES

Nepalese observe Mother's Day in Kathmandu

Nepalese people observe Mother's Day in Kathmandu on May 9, 2013 by presenting sweets and gifts to their mothers, while those whose mothers have passed away honour their souls with prayers at temples, taking holy dips, and presenting offerings.

Join ST's Telegram channel and get the latest breaking news delivered to you.